    Senior Finance Executive

    As a Senior Finance Executive, you will be responsible for managing the company’s financial operations, reporting, budgeting, and compliance processes. You will ensure financial accuracy, provide insights to support decision-making, and help maintain strong financial controls to support business growth and sustainability.

    Responsibilities:

    • Manage day-to-day financial operations, including accounting, reporting, and reconciliation
    •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ports
    • Develop and monitor budgets, forecasts, and cash flow
    • Ensure compliance with financial regulations, tax requirements, and internal policies
    • Oversee accounts payable, accounts receivable, and payroll processes
    • Support management with financial analysis and decision-making insights
    • Monitor expenses and identify cost control opportunities
    • Coordinate audits and liaise with external auditors, consultants, and regulatory bodies
    • Maintain accurate financial records and documentation
    • Improve financial processes, systems, and controls
    • Support strategic planning and business growth initiatives
    • Other duties as assigned

    Requirements:

    •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related field
    • Professional qualification (ACA, ACCA, CIMA, or equivalent) is required
    • At least 5 years’ proven experience in finance or accounting, with senior-level exposure
    • Strong knowledge of financial reporting, budgeting, and compliance
    • Proficiency in accounting software and financial tools
    •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
    • High attention to detail and accuracy
    •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ities
    • High level of integrity and professionalism
